mysql

package
v1.0.9 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Apr 2, 2023 License: MIT Imports: 2 Imported by: 0

Documentation

Overview

Package mysql fornece uma implementação de um adaptador de conexão MySQL.

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type MysqlDB added in v1.0.7

type MysqlDB struct {
	// contains filtered or unexported fields
}

MysqlDB é uma estrutura que contém um cliente *sql.DB.

func NewDB

func NewDB(dsn string) (*MysqlDB, error)

NewDB cria uma nova instância do adaptador MySQL e retorna um ponteiro para ela. A função recebe uma string de conexão (DSN) como argumento e retorna um erro, se houver algum.

func (*MysqlDB) Client added in v1.0.8

func (db *MysqlDB) Client() *sql.DB

Client retorna o cliente *sql.DB armazenado na estrutura MysqlDB.

func (*MysqlDB) Close added in v1.0.7

func (db *MysqlDB) Close() error

Close fecha a conexão com o banco de dados MySQL. Retorna um erro, se houver algum.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L